巧妙地地方在于,点击表单右上角 × 号时,会触发表单的, close 事件,而 close 事件绑定取消按钮的处理事件 btnCancle 事件 ,点击确认按钮时也会触发 btnCancle 事件,最终三个按钮都可以触发同一个事件, 因为取消按钮点击事件名为 btnCancle (关闭弹层都会触发 close 事件) 1.确认按钮 确认按钮要做的事很多如下:...
很明显函数被执行两次,根据逻辑如果第二次触发的是同一个按钮则会取消选择,那么问题来了,明明我只是点击了一次,为什么函数会被执行两次呢。 于是我先查看element-plus中radio-button.vue文件的部分源码,源码如下 <template>
<el-tabs v-model="activeName" @tab-click="handleClick"> <el-tab-pane label="用户管理" name="first">用户管理</el-tab-pane> <el-tab-pane label="配置管理" name="second">配置管理</el-tab-pane> <el-tab-pane label="角色管理" name="third">角色管理</el-tab-pane> <el-tab-pane la...
你好,通过该种方式确实可以聚焦到按钮上了,但是不仅仅是聚焦,还自动触发了该按钮的点击事件……… 之前我是通过tab按键,切换到按钮上,然后按下enter键触发点击事件的; 现在是聚焦到按钮后,立马就触发了点击事件,应该也不是事件冒泡或者捕获,因为他们没有共同的父元素; 请问这种情况是正常的吗?如果focus聚焦到按钮...
当前使用vue3@3.2.30 + element-plus@2.0.2,封装的el-autocomplete组件使用的vue2的写法。 一、问题描述 用element 的输入建议框,在点击清空按钮后,如果输入框已经是聚焦状态,再次输入内容时建议框不显示。el-autocomplete组件在执行清除事件时,将activated置为了false。当querySearch执行成功,activated仍为false,所以下...
在input number组件中,加减按钮事件是一种常见的交互行为。当用户点击加减按钮时,我们可以监听对应的事件来执行相应的操作。Element Plus的input number组件为我们提供了两个常用的事件:increment和decrement。通过监听这两个事件,我们可以增加或减少数值,并且可以在事件处理函数中执行自定义逻辑。 第四部分:使用加减按钮事...
log('点击搜索') } } } 这样,当在输入框中按下 Enter 键时,就会触发按钮的点击事件。 有用 回复 Yonggie: 你好,el button提示`slot` attributes are deprecated.,使用嵌套写法会出现多余的input框,所以element plus应该用不了这个方法。 回复2023-04-21 来自广东 查看全部 ...
为了验证引入的element-plus以及应用的可运行性,在app.vue页面引入了<el-button>按钮代码。 如下图示: 发现界面自动更新,展示出了对应的按钮控件。 如下图示: 这说明项目中的HMR(Hot Module Replacement)已经生效。 我们继续为按钮添加一个点击事件,单击弹出一个Alert提示框。
ElementPlus 组件支持事件绑定,可以通过 v-on 指令来绑定事件。例如,绑定点击事件,可以通过 @click 来实现。 <template> <el-button type="primary" @click="handleClick"> 点击事件 </el-button> </template> export default { methods: { handleClick() { console.log('点击按钮'); }, }, }; 动态...